What is a Web-Based Assessment
A Web-Based Assessment is a modern method of evaluating knowledge, skills, or personality traits using internet-connected digital platforms. By transitioning away from traditional paper tests, academic institutions and corporate enterprises can create, distribute, and analyze exams with incredible efficiency.
Instead of manually printing and grading hundreds of test booklets, administrators can utilize cloud-based software to deploy a single Digital Evaluation to thousands of participants globally. This scalable approach provides instant, data-driven feedback, allowing organizations to make faster, highly accurate decisions.
Key Characteristics and Components
To fully understand the scope of digital testing, it is important to examine the core components that drive these platforms:
- Types and Functions: Digital testing is highly versatile. It encompasses everything from low-stakes interactive quizzes and basic self-evaluations to rigorous, high-stakes Competency-Based Assessment models used for critical hiring decisions. The testing logic can even be adaptive, meaning the difficulty of the questions changes in real time based on the user’s previous answers.
- Platforms and Tools: The software market offers a wide variety of tools tailored to specific needs. For casual classroom engagement, applications like Kahoot or Google Forms are widely used. For complex enterprise evaluations, organizations rely on specialized, highly secure platforms like iMocha, ClassMarker, or open-source TAO systems.
- Dynamic Features: The most powerful features of these systems include automated scoring algorithms, dynamic multimedia question formats like live coding simulators, and seamless integration with a central Learning Management System (LMS).
Key Advantages
Moving evaluations online provides massive strategic benefits over traditional paper methods:
- Increased Efficiency and Speed: Automated grading systems completely eliminate human scoring errors and provide instantaneous results to both the test taker and the administrator.
- Unmatched Flexibility: It offers ultimate convenience for the test taker, who can complete the evaluation from absolutely anywhere in the world at their preferred time.
- Cost Reduction: It drastically reduces administrative overhead, printing costs, and the need to rent physical testing venues.
- Global Scalability: Institutions can reach a massive global audience simultaneously without increasing their logistical workload.
Limitations and Challenges
While highly effective, digital testing does present a few specific hurdles:
- Technological Dependence: The primary drawback is the absolute dependence on a stable internet connection. If a user loses connectivity, their progress can be severely disrupted.
- System Costs: Proprietary testing systems can be expensive for small organizations to license and maintain over time.
- Security Concerns: Because candidates test remotely, there is a high potential for cheating if proper security measures are not enforced. To combat this, institutions frequently pair their testing platforms with strict Online Exam Proctoring software to secure the digital environment.
Examples of Use Cases
Because of their extreme flexibility, digital testing tools are utilized across a massive variety of industries and scenarios:
- Educational Settings: Teachers and university professors use formative digital quizzes to measure student comprehension continuously. Platforms allow educators to create interactive learning modules that keep students actively engaged.
- Corporate Settings: Talent acquisition teams rely heavily on these tools to screen massive volumes of applicants before the interview stage. By reviewing the automated Talent Analytics generated by the tests, recruiters can quickly and objectively identify the most qualified candidates.
- Real-Time Feedback: Corporate trainers and event speakers use simple digital polling tools to gather instant, anonymous audience insights during live presentations.
